2A Mile End Road Norwich NR4 7QY Data via plota.co.uk
Proposal
T1: Yew - reduce height of tree from 8.5m to 7m and from its current width of 6m to 4.5m. Data via plota.co.uk
Application progress
This application is under consideration - no decision has been issued yet. Plota predicts a decision between 8 Oct 2026 and 15 Oct 2026, from Norwich's recent tree and landscaping works.

Norwich is faster than most councils at deciding householder applications, ranking #68 out of 296. Only 22% of applications have the time limit extended, well below the 41% national average - the council usually decides on time. Householder applications are more likely to be approved here than most councils, with a 97% approval rate vs 90% nationally.
